Output e539613a30d03b1e462ad73434e28a9bcc6ede0ecf2e606bd37a5954e9afb607:0

value
101849795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e23939d29d65cd38aee2a7bbc6d93ce75132c0ee OP_EQUAL
address
3NKBC29VDZZ59e84MxQHgDaCAKK1jnUZco
transaction
e539613a30d03b1e462ad73434e28a9bcc6ede0ecf2e606bd37a5954e9afb607
confirmations
319082
spent
true